[0003] This application relates to the field of medical device technology, and more specifically, to valve stents and valve prostheses for surgical procedures. Background Technology
[0004] Replacing the original diseased valve with an artificial heart valve prosthesis through traditional surgery is one of the important methods for treating valvular heart disease. This procedure allows for good exposure of the heart and major blood vessels, facilitating surgical manipulation, and is particularly suitable for patients with multiple valves, complex lesions, or those requiring multiple surgical procedures or complex operations during surgery. Current surgical valve prostheses generally consist of two parts: a support structure called the valve frame, which provides support and fixation; and a moving unit called the valve leaflet, which enables opening and closing, allowing blood flow and preventing backflow. The valve leaflet is usually made of bio-based materials, including bovine or porcine pericardium. However, bio-based materials are prone to calcification and damage, leading to leaflet calcification, decay, or fatigue failure, reducing the durability of the valve prosthesis. Furthermore, valve leaflets made of bio-based materials are typically sutured to the valve frame. With each heartbeat, the leaflets constantly change position under the pressure of blood flow. Over time, stress and friction can cause tearing and damage at the suture sites, similarly reducing the durability of the valve prosthesis.
[0005] Compared with traditional bioprosthetic valve leaflets, polymeric valve leaflets have the advantages of excellent durability, low cost and industrial production capability, making them a current research hotspot. However, since polymeric valve leaflets are coated on the valve frame, the long-term stability of valve prostheses needs to be verified.

[0049] As shown in Figure 2, this embodiment of the application provides a surgical valve frame. The valve frame, as the main support structure of the valve prosthesis, provides stable support for the artificial valve leaflet 5. The valve prosthesis is implanted into the designated position and achieves pulsation function at the expected location. When the valve prosthesis closes, the artificial valve leaflet 5 bears a certain pressure from the blood in the body. The stress concentration is greatest in the hanging corner area of the artificial valve leaflet 5. At this time, the artificial valve leaflet 5 transfers this load to the valve frame connected to it. Because the valve frame in this embodiment of the application is flexible, it can store the pressure transmitted by the artificial valve leaflet 5 as potential energy and release it as kinetic energy at an appropriate time. This action alleviates the stress concentration of the artificial valve leaflet 5 when it closes, thereby delaying fatigue damage at the location of maximum stress concentration and increasing the fatigue durability life of the valve prosthesis.
[0050] As shown in Figures 1 and 2, the valve frame includes a base 1 and a support 2 extending from the base 1. The support 2 is used to connect the artificial valve leaflet 5. The support 2 is provided with a coating area for coating a polymer membrane. The coating area is provided with a coating reinforcement 31 extending inward along the thickness direction of the support 2. The coating reinforcement 31 increases the bonding area between the valve frame and the polymer membrane, and improves the connection force between the valve frame and the polymer membrane. Since the artificial valve leaflet 5 made of polymer synthetic material is connected to the valve frame through the polymer membrane covering the valve frame, the coating reinforcement 31 improves the connection force between the polymer membrane and the valve frame. Therefore, the artificial valve leaflet 5 made of polymer synthetic material can be better connected to the valve frame, thereby improving the durability of the valve prosthesis.
[0051] Meanwhile, the membrane reinforcement 31 has a concave structure, which reduces the weight of the entire valve frame and makes the local wall thickness of the valve frame thinner. Compared with the planar structure, the thinned area of the valve frame in this embodiment is easier to deform, which also improves the flexibility of the valve frame, relieves the stress concentration of the artificial leaflet 5 when it is closed, relieves the artificial leaflet 5 from fatigue damage, and improves the service life of the valve prosthesis.
[0052] Optionally, the base 1 and the support 2 are integrally formed to improve the structural strength of the petiole frame.
[0053] Optionally, the valve frame can be made of PEEK material. The valve frame can be made of medical-grade PEEK material, which has good support and flexibility, ensuring that sufficient structural strength can be achieved even when the valve frame height is designed during fabrication.
[0054] Of course, as another implementation, a coating area can also be provided on the base 1 and the support 2, that is, a part of the coating area is provided on the base 1 and another part of the coating area is provided on the support 2.
[0055] Optionally, the petal frame is formed by a support portion 2 of tapered sheet material, wherein the thickness of the support portion 2 gradually decreases from bottom to top.
[0056] Optionally, the number of support parts 2 is three, and they are evenly spaced. The three support parts 2 are evenly distributed on the annular base 1 of the petiole frame, that is, the included angle between the lines connecting two adjacent support parts 2 to the center of the petiole frame is 120°.
[0057] As shown in Figures 1 and 3, in one embodiment, the membrane reinforcement 31 extends into a closed area on the support 2, so that the valve frame has flexibility while meeting the structural strength requirements, which can alleviate the problem of valve prosthesis durability failure caused by high stress concentration of artificial leaflet 5.
[0058] Of course, the membrane reinforcement 31 can also extend to form a closed area on the base 1 and the support 2, which can also make the valve frame flexible while meeting the structural strength requirements, and can alleviate the problem of valve prosthesis durability failure caused by high stress concentration of artificial valve leaflet 5.
[0059] Optionally, the closed area formed by the coating reinforcement 31 can be triangular, circular, or other closed shapes.
[0060] As shown in Figure 3, in one embodiment, the closed area enclosed by the membrane reinforcement 31 penetrates through the thickness direction of the support 2, thereby making a part of the support 2 a through hole, reducing the weight of the valve frame, and also changing the local thickness of the support 2. While satisfying the overall structural strength of the valve frame, it also makes the valve frame flexible. At the artificial valve hanging corner position, it will swing inward and outward with the pulsation of the human body, which can convert the potential energy accumulated by the artificial valve leaflet 5 into kinetic energy release, and alleviate the problem of damage to the artificial valve stress concentration position caused by fatigue and durability.
[0061] As shown in Figure 1, in one embodiment, the closed area enclosed by the membrane reinforcement 31 forms the bottom wall 33, thereby reducing the local thickness of the support 2 and reducing the weight of the valve frame. While satisfying the overall structural strength of the valve frame, it also makes the valve frame flexible. At the artificial valve hanging corner, it will swing inward and outward with the pulsation of the human body, which can convert the accumulated potential energy of the artificial valve leaflet 5 into kinetic energy release, and alleviate the problem of damage to the artificial valve stress concentration position caused by fatigue and durability.
[0062] As one implementation, the bottom wall 33 is provided with a membrane reinforcement texture (not shown in the figure). On the one hand, it can increase the structural strength of the membrane reinforcement part 31, thereby increasing the overall structural strength of the valve frame; on the other hand, it can also increase the bonding area between the valve frame and the polymer membrane, increase the connection force between the valve frame and the polymer membrane, and also improve the durability of the valve prosthesis.
[0063] Optionally, the reinforcing texture can be in the form of raised ribs; or it can be in the form of grooves that are radially recessed along the bottom wall 33.
[0064] As shown in Figures 1 and 3, in one embodiment, the membrane reinforcement 31 is provided with steps or patterns, which can increase the structural strength of the membrane reinforcement 31, thereby increasing the overall structural strength of the valve frame; on the other hand, it can also increase the bonding area between the valve frame and the polymer membrane, increase the connection force between the valve frame and the polymer membrane, and also improve the durability of the valve prosthesis.
[0065] As shown in Figures 1 and 3, in one embodiment, the base 1 is provided with a plurality of holes 11 penetrating the base 1 in the circumferential direction, so that the circumference of the valve frame can be flexible, and at the same time, it is convenient to connect the valve frame and the artificial valve ring by stitching.
[0066] As shown in Figure 4, in one embodiment, the base 1 is provided with at least one connecting part 4 for increasing the contact area with the artificial valve annulus. The radial dimension of the connecting part 4 is the same as the radial dimension of the base 1. By providing the connecting part 4, the contact area between the valve frame and the artificial valve annulus becomes thicker in the height direction. The connecting part 4 and the base 1 can increase the contact area with the artificial valve annulus, thereby improving the stability of the valve prosthesis and extending the service life of the valve prosthesis.
[0067] Optionally, one or more connecting parts 4 may be provided.
[0068] Optionally, the connecting part 4 is also provided with a through hole that communicates with the hole 11 on the base part 1.
[0069] As shown in Figure 5, in one embodiment, the valve frame also includes a connecting segment 6. The radial dimension of the first end of the connecting segment 6 is smaller than the radial dimension of the base 1, and the radial dimension of the second end is larger than the radial dimension of the first end. That is, the local radial dimension of the connecting segment 6 is smaller than the radial dimension of the base 1. The first end of the connecting segment 6 is connected to the base 1, and a groove 61 for engaging with the artificial valve annulus is formed between the two, which facilitates the connection between the artificial valve annulus and the valve frame. In addition, it also improves the stability between the artificial valve annulus and the valve frame.
[0070] In one implementation, the surface of the valve frame is covered with a polymer film.
[0071] After the petiole frame is formed, before the artificial petiole 5 is formed on the petiole frame, a polymer film is pre-coated on the outer and inner surfaces of the petiole frame. Usually, the petiole frame is placed in a molten polymer layer material, and after cooling, a polymer film is formed on the outer and inner surfaces of the petiole frame. The polymer film facilitates better connection between the petiole frame and the artificial petiole 5.
[0072] Optionally, the artificial valve annulus has a ring structure and multiple arc-shaped protrusions, making it suitable for fitting the aortic valve.
[0073] Furthermore, this application provides a surgical valve prosthesis, including the surgical valve frame provided in the aforementioned embodiments, and an artificial valve leaflet 5 made of polymer synthetic material, which can be connected to the support portion 2, or of course, can also be connected to the polymer membrane on the support portion 2.
[0074] Artificial leaflets made of polymer synthetic materials have better durability than biological leaflets.
[0075] Optionally, the polymer membrane material on the surface of the petiole frame can be the same as the material of the petiole leaf, because the petiole frame and the artificial petiole leaf 5 are heterogeneous materials, and the polymer membrane of the same material as the artificial petiole leaf 5 improves the stability and consistency of the artificial petiole leaf 5 on the petiole frame.
[0076] Optionally, the thickness of the artificial leaflet 5 is uniform, and the thickness of the artificial leaflet 5 can be controlled within 0.09mm to 0.15mm.
[0077] Optionally, the artificial leaflet 5 can be made of TPU composite material (Thermoplastic polyurethanes). The artificial leaflet 5 made of TPU composite material has the same structural design, overall weight, tissue and thickness at all locations. The artificial leaflet 5 with uniform thickness can have a larger flow area when in the open position, further reducing the transvalvular pressure gradient. Moreover, the artificial leaflet 5 made of TPU composite material can reduce valve calcification problems in multiple tests, thereby improving the service life of surgically implanted artificial valves.
[0078] Of course, artificial leaflets 5 can also be made of SEBS styrene-ethylene-butene-styrene block copolymer or SPU silane-modified polyurethane.
